Terracotta kantharos (drinking cup with high handles)
Unknown
4th century BCE · Terracotta · Greek and Roman Art

Although black-glazed wares often represent cheaper versions of metal vases, the precise execution and beautiful black gloss make them attractive objects in their own right.
